Sniping should count as a Mind stat. Its already independent of the strength stat, so why is it a Martial art?
It is listed under weapon styles, but Navigation for example uses a weapon (clima tact), too.
Also, 100 Martial arts gives you a total of 15 full stat points, spread between strength...